General notes
ab250510 is the carrier-free version of ab181579.
Our carrier-free antibodies are typically supplied in a PBS-only formulation, purified and free of BSA, sodium azide and glycerol. The carrier-free buffer and high concentration allow for increased conjugation efficiency.
This conjugation-ready format is designed for use with fluorochromes, metal isotopes, oligonucleotides, and enzymes, which makes them ideal for antibody labelling, functional and cell-based assays, flow-based assays (e.g. mass cytometry) and Multiplex Imaging applications.

Target
-
Function
Involved in the activation cascade of caspases responsible for apoptosis execution. Cleaves and activates sterol regulatory element binding proteins (SREBPs). Proteolytically cleaves poly(ADP-ribose) polymerase (PARP) at a '216-Asp-
-Gly-217' bond. Overexpression promotes programmed cell death. -
Tissue specificity
Highly expressed in lung, skeletal muscle, liver, kidney, spleen and heart, and moderately in testis. No expression in the brain. -
Sequence similarities
Belongs to the peptidase C14A family. -
Post-translational
modificationsCleavages by granzyme B or caspase-10 generate the two active subunits. Propeptide domains can also be cleaved efficiently by caspase-3. Active heterodimers between the small subunit of caspase-7 and the large subunit of caspase-3, and vice versa, also occur. -
Cellular localization
Cytoplasm. - Information by UniProt

Secondary
All lanes : Goat Anti-Rabbit IgG, (H+L), Peroxidase conjugated at 1/1000 dilution
Predicted band size: 34 kDa
Observed band size: 35,32,27 kDa why is the actual band size different from the predicted?This data was developed using ab181579, the same antibody clone in a different buffer formulation.
Blocking and dilution buffer: 5% NFDM/TBST.
Observed band size: 35kDa band is the pro-Caspase 7, 32kDa band is the N-terminal propeptide cleaved Caspase 7, and the 27kDa band is an N-terminal truncated caspase 7.
